Key Responsibilities

Team Leadership & Support

Lead a unit or team of contract analysts, giving guidance, training, direction, and hands-on support.

Help schedule, assign, and monitor work for team members, ensuring completeness, accuracy, and alignment with departmental standards.

Provide performance feedback and input to senior leadership on team member evaluations.

Estimate staffing, equipment, and materials needed for projects or jobs.

Contracts, Compliance & Oversight

Prepare summary reports on contractor performance based on inspection and review documents.

Conduct desk reviews and in-field inspections of contracted services to verify contract standards are met consistently.

Perform contracting feasibility and cost-analysis studies; prepare reports and recommendations.

Participate in negotiation of complex contract terms, amendments, and agreements.

Engage in legal research of applicable laws/regulations, assess legislative changes' impacts, and consult with legal counsel as needed.

Advise operational teams regarding contractual or funding issues and resolve disputes with contractors.

Ensure contractor compliance with requirements such as licensures, insurance, and applicable ordinances (e.g. Living Wage, Jury Duty).

Recommend policies, procedures, forms, and tools to streamline contract development.

Continuous Improvement & Strategy

Identify areas for process improvement in contracting and administrative operations.

Collaborate with leadership on planning and implementing policy changes.

Track trends, risks, and compliance issues; provide data and insights to guide organizational decisions.
